RN Acute Care
Shifts Available: Full-Time, 36 hours per week, Night Shift
Required Qualifications:
- Graduation from an accredited nursing program.
- Washington Registered Nurse License upon hire.
- National Provider BLS - American Heart Association upon hire.
- National Provider ACLS - American Heart Association upon hire.
- National Provider PALS - American Heart Association upon hire.
- One (1) year Nursing experience.
RN Resident Acute Care
Shifts Available: Full-Time, 36 hours per week, Night Shift
Required Qualifications:
- Graduation from an accredited nursing program.
- Washington Registered Nurse License upon hire.
- National Provider BLS - American Heart Association upon hire.
- National Provider ACLS - American Heart Association within 6 months (180 days) of hire.
- National Provider PALS - American Heart Association within 6 months (180 days) of hire.
- Graduation from an accredited nursing program and is newly licensed with 12 months of experience or less.
